55/*
56 * Kernel descriptor table.
57 * One entry for each open kernel vnode and socket.
58 */
59struct file {
60 LIST_ENTRY(file) f_list;/* list of active files */
61 short f_FILLER3; /* (old f_flag) */
62#define DTYPE_VNODE 1 /* file */
63#define DTYPE_SOCKET 2 /* communications endpoint */
64#define DTYPE_PIPE 3 /* pipe */
65#define DTYPE_FIFO 4 /* fifo (named pipe) */
66#define DTYPE_KQUEUE 5 /* event queue */
67#define DTYPE_CRYPTO 6 /* crypto */
68 short f_type; /* descriptor type */
69 u_int f_flag; /* see fcntl.h */
70 struct ucred *f_cred; /* credentials associated with descriptor */
71 struct fileops {
72 int (*fo_read) __P((struct file *fp, struct uio *uio,
73 struct ucred *cred, int flags,
74 struct thread *td));
75 int (*fo_write) __P((struct file *fp, struct uio *uio,
76 struct ucred *cred, int flags,
77 struct thread *td));
78#define FOF_OFFSET 1
79 int (*fo_ioctl) __P((struct file *fp, u_long com,
80 caddr_t data, struct thread *td));
81 int (*fo_poll) __P((struct file *fp, int events,
82 struct ucred *cred, struct thread *td));
83 int (*fo_kqfilter) __P((struct file *fp,
84 struct knote *kn));
85 int (*fo_stat) __P((struct file *fp, struct stat *sb,
86 struct thread *td));
87 int (*fo_close) __P((struct file *fp, struct thread *td));
88 } *f_ops;
89 int f_seqcount; /*
90 * count of sequential accesses -- cleared
91 * by most seek operations.
92 */
93 off_t f_nextoff; /*
94 * offset of next expected read or write
95 */
96 off_t f_offset;
97 caddr_t f_data; /* vnode or socket */
98 int f_count; /* reference count */
99 int f_msgcount; /* reference count from message queue */
100};
